Pursued by Bear Blushing Bear Rose 2021
Inspired by the classic Bandol roses of southern France, the 2021 Blushing Bear is a delicate, pale pink wine redolent of summer. Fresh and aromatic, flavorful sun-kissed wild strawberries, juicy white peach, succulent guava, and a hint of orange peel burst from the glass. A wine of impeccable balance with playful flavors that give way to a serious, textured mouthfeel and a long, lively fmish. Cue the sunglasses!

Winery Description
Actor Kyle Maclachlan (Twin Peaks, Blue Velvet, The Doors, and many other films) is a native of Washington State's Columbia Valley winegrowing region. Washington State wine has brought Kyle back home to the Pacific Northwest to craft small lots of limited production red wines and a rosé that speak to the promise of this special terroir. Not with nostalgia, but with a new story to tell… a story of uncompromising quality and unlimited possibility.
Kyle felt connected to nature from his earliest memories, growing up among his father’s expansive gardens and the gnarled old fruit trees of Yakima, Washington. His interest in wine began in the mid-1980's after moving to Los Angeles to pursue his acting career. Frequently returning to Yakima to visit his father and his home, he began to explore the burgeoning Washington wine scene. Later, inspired by friends in Napa Valley, the notion of making his own Washington wine took hold. Kyle set out to create Cabernet Sauvignon and Syrah that expressed the local terroir - an alluring mix of Old World elegance and New World grandeur. It wasn't long before a chance meeting with Walla Walla winemaker Eric Dunham led to a simple handshake that launched Pursued by Bear in 2005. In 2008, Eric passed the winemaking baton to veteran winemaker Daniel Wampfler, who continues to craft Pursued by Bear wines with the same passion and care that Eric inspired.
